Searched refs:BlockStart (Results 1 - 2 of 2) sorted by relevance

/external/llvm/lib/CodeGen/
H A DSplitKit.cpp879 SlotIndex BlockStart, BlockEnd; local
880 tie(BlockStart, BlockEnd) = LIS.getSlotIndexes()->getMBBRange(MBB);
883 if (Start != BlockStart) {
884 VNInfo *VNI = LI->extendInBlock(BlockStart, std::min(BlockEnd, End));
893 BlockStart = BlockEnd;
897 assert(Start <= BlockStart && "Expected live-in block");
898 while (BlockStart < End) {
901 if (BlockStart == ParentVNI->def) {
904 VNInfo *VNI = LI->extendInBlock(BlockStart, std::min(BlockEnd, End));
919 BlockStart
[all...]
H A DLiveIntervalAnalysis.cpp699 SlotIndex BlockStart = getMBBStartIdx(MBB);
702 if (VNInfo *ExtVNI = NewLI.extendInBlock(BlockStart, Idx)) {
706 if (!VNI->isPHIDef() || VNI->def != BlockStart || !UsedPHIs.insert(VNI))
722 DEBUG(dbgs() << " live-in at " << BlockStart << '\n');
723 NewLI.addRange(LiveRange(BlockStart, Idx, VNI));

Completed in 54 milliseconds